Hi reckless
You cannot remove negative accounts from your credit report if it is correct. But you can definitely remove incorrect info from your report by disputing it with the bureaus. You can find sample dispute letters if you visit the debt settlement letters section.

you can call or write "goodwill" letters to the creditor explaining what the situation was to get you into debt, and what you are doing to stay out of the same situation again. You can ask them to not respond to a credit bureau dispute, or ask them to alter how they report your tradeline. If you google or search here for goodwill letters you will probably find some that have worked for other people.
